Three faculty members of the University of Louisiana at Monroe School of Pharmacy have recently been elected to the board of the Louisiana Society of Health System Pharmacists, a trade organization that supports clinical and hospital pharmacists and technicians.

Dr. Roxie Stewart, Clinical Assistant Professor in Pharmacy at the University of Louisiana at Monroe and the new President-Elect of the organization explains the role of LSHP in development of pharmacists throughout the state. The Society now serves over 1,000 members and is a state affiliate of the American Society of Health-System Pharmacists.

Also elected to the board of directors from ULM were Assistant Professor Dr. Brice Mohundro and Clinical Assistant Professor Dr. Jessica Brady.
